THE CHRISTIAN GOSPEL
A SHORT ACCOUNT OF THE MOMENTOUS NEWS ABOUT JESUS CHRIST
The teaching of Jesus and his followers has profoundly shaped our world and continues to influence Western society—even if we don’t always realize it.
At the center of that teaching is a surprising focus: the meaning of Jesus’ death on a Roman cross and the claim that he rose from the dead. But what does this centuries-old message have to do with us today?
To answer that, we must ask: Why is Jesus called “Christ”? Why is his death unique? Can his resurrection be believed, and why does it matter? Most importantly—if this message is true, does it really bring the peace, joy, and hope Jesus promised?
In this short, highly readable book, Tony Payne tackles these questions directly and compellingly.
